Is React JS the perfect choice for web app development
Web apps have become the meeting interface for enterprises and clients in today’s digital environment, resulting in new collaborations. Web apps have large shoes to fill for greater customer interaction now that the global corporate sector has gone digital and plans to go the additional mile to guarantee that the consumer experience is a class apart. ReactJS is one of the most popular JavaScript libraries for developing web applications.
Apart from being highly popular among young companies, it is utilized by some of the industry’s biggest brands, including IBM, Walmart, Paypal, Netflix, Groupon, Yahoo!, New York Times, LinkedIn, and many more.
While there are alternative frameworks for Web Application Development, ReactJS is a superior option. In this post, we’ll look at why ReactJS is a superior choice for developing web applications.
ReactJS is an open-source and cost-free JavaScript library. It provides high-end Web Application Development services for creating user-centric apps with stunning user interfaces. It contains a lot of documentation and has garnered a lot of momentum among developers in a short amount of time.
ReactJS, which was created by the Facebook community, is powered by some of the most professional developers from Instagram and Facebook, as well as a significant number of developers from all over the world. React developers may utilize their JavaScript skills to design user interfaces that excite users.
ReactJS has a lot of great features that make it one of the most popular frameworks in the world.
Table of Contents
ReactJS’s Advantages
The following are some of the major advantages of using ReactJS Development Services:
Reusability of Code
ReactJS allows you to create components, which are reusable portions of code. These components may be reused whenever needed, saving time and effort spent creating code from the ground up. Components simplify debugging and maintenance while also conserving resources.
Scripting becomes simpler with ReactJS
ReactJS makes scripting a breeze by providing a free syntactic extension called JSX that simplifies debugging. HTML quoting is simple with JSX because it gives useful error indications and notifications, allowing syntax mistakes to be easily corrected. As a result, your code becomes much more readable and tidy.
These HTML mockups may be converted into ReactElement trees using ReactJS. As a result, you can easily create top-tier apps.
High Performance with Virtual DOM
Unlike other JavaScript frameworks, ReactJS employs Virtual DOM for element changes, rather than Real DOM. When a modification is made to the JSX, it is updated in one of the Virtual DOMs, and the difference is compared to the other Virtual DOM. This discrepancy is then updated immediately in the Real DOM, speeding up the entire process.
Some other explanation for ReactJS’s high speed is because it supports both server-side and client-side rendering, which boosts overall performance and speeds up processing.
- ReactJS is cost-effective since it is open source and provides a free web application development framework with no license fees. This saves you a lot of money and lowers the overall cost of your project.
- ReactJS is straightforward to understand, which is why many developers across the world are interested in learning it. That’s why, according to a Stack Overflow research from 2019, it’s one of the most popular web development frameworks.
- ReactJS aids in the development of SEO-friendly applications, increasing the total exposure of your business online by ranking it in search results. This increases the total reach of your business, making it easier for your target audience to find you.
Now that you understand why ReactJS is a superior choice for your next web application, you must use the power of ReactJS development to optimize your web app.
When it comes to selecting the ideal framework for web app development, there are several variables to consider. ReactJS is an excellent choice for developing online apps, especially for large-scale companies, because of its speed, reliability, and cost. It’s no surprise that even behemoths like Twitter, Instagram, and Netflix have put their faith in this architecture. These frameworks are rapidly developing and are in direct rivalry with one another. Any app’s success depends on combining the finest technology and design.